Crowdfunding and Crowd-Investing Platform Management is a course devoted to the theoretical foundations and practical management of crowdfunding and crowd-investing as modern instruments of attracting finance. The course helps students understand how collective financing mechanisms operate, how digital platforms connect entrepreneurs and investors, and how these tools can be applied in real economic practice. It also develops practical skills in retrospective analysis of financial and economic activities, preparation of investment projects, cost planning, and the development of long-term financial plans and budgets.

In the modern world, the importance of this course is steadily growing, as digital platforms are transforming traditional approaches to finance, investment, and entrepreneurship. Crowdfunding and crowd-investing have become significant mechanisms for supporting innovation, small businesses, startups, and socially important initiatives. Understanding how these platforms function and how to manage projects within them enables students to respond to current market trends, expand access to financial resources, and work effectively in the evolving digital economy.
